Bright rainbow created by Sun low in west just about to set with raindrops in the air to the east, and light rain falling at the time. Taken with Canon 7D and 10-22mm lens at 10mm, in two sections, stitched together in Photoshop. Note: bright interior region inside inner bow, darker exterior region, supernumerary arcs along inside edge of inner bow at top, reversal of colours in two bows, and bright red portion of the spectrum from very red sunlight from low sun angle. Taken from southern Alberta, Canada.
